1.When charging, please put this product on a dried or ventilated area and keep
it far away from heat source or explosive product.
2.When charging, please remove the batteries from the quadcopter. Then
charging process should be supervised by an adult so as not to cause an
accident.
3.After flying, please do not charge the battery if the surface temperature is still
not cool. Otherwise it may cause a swollen battery or even a fire hazard.
4.Please make sure that you use the original USB charging cable provided.When
the battery has been used for a long time, or appears to be swollen, please
replace them.
5.A battery when not in use for a long time will lose its charge automatically.
Charging or discharging too often may reduce the life of the battery.

1.Battery should be put in the dried or ventilated place with enviroment
temperature about 18-25.
2.In order to enhance the using life of the battery, please avoid repeat charging
or excessive discharging.
3.When the battery needs to be stored for a long time,please charge the battery
first.That is to say, charge the battery for about 50-60% of the volume and then
well store it.
4.If you do not use it for more than 1 months, it’s highly recommended that you
need to check the battery voltage every month so as to make sure the voltage
no less than 3V. Otherwise please do by following No.(3) mentioned.

INTRODUCTION TO QUADCOPTER FUNCTIONS

Low-Voltage Protection

Rotors stop automatically when battery power is insufficient for safe operation.

Over-Current Protection

Control system stops rotor power if blades collide or jam to prevent damage.
